Supply chain visibility has become a valuable commodity for the fashion industry as regulations, reputational risks and sustainability concerns drive companies to peel back the curtain on more links of their production. It is no longer enough to just know Tier 1 or Tier 2 factories; brands must know their entire value chain to back up claims and substantiate credible authenticity around the origin and supply chain of the product. In the increasingly regulated sourcing environment, material provenance has become an equally important sourcing criteria to a textile’s aesthetic or hand feel. For cotton in particular, brands and their consumers want to know exactly where the fiber is produced to understand its sustainability profile and circumvent compliance risks.
